Is there a way for me to make a copy of a shared form and have it be my own form? I created several forms in one account, but I need them to be owned by another account, so sharing them doesn't fulfill my need.

To clone the form, you need the URL of the form itself. Unfortunately, the URL of a page the form is embedded to will not work. The form embedded to the page in your screenshot is:
http://www.jotform.us/form/52106012902136
You can clone it via that URL.
To find the URL of any of your forms, while editing them, click on the "Embed Form" tab:
Under the "Your form is here!" heading will be the URL of your form. You can clone it to other accounts from that URL.
